ERIELL KAM is a joint Afghan–Uzbek oil and gas company, dedicated to advancing Afghanistan’s hydrocarbons sector through the technical excellence of ERIELL Management (Uzbekistan), the operational leadership of Kam Energy (Afghanistan), and the resource expertise of Uzbekneftegaz (UNG). ERIELL KAM is registered in Afghanistan, functions as a technical contractor, operator, and energy investor focused on exploration, drilling, and engineering. Driven by innovation and national purpose, we develop Afghanistan’s energy potential through sustainable projects that strengthen economic self-reliance
